During the USA, Medicaid is a government-funded medical insurance program that offers coverage for low-income people and families. While Medicaid generally covers necessary clinical services, there can be variants in insurance coverage depending upon state-specific standards. One usual concern amongst those that call for adult diapers is whether Medicaid will certainly cover the price of these crucial supplies.

Medicaid Coverage for Adult Diapers.

The insurance coverage of grown-up diapers under Medicaid can differ significantly from one state to another. While some states explicitly include grown-up baby diapers as a covered benefit, others might have constraints or require extra documents.

Factors Influencing Protection.

Several aspects can affect whether Medicaid will certainly cover adult diapers in a particular state:.

State Medicaid Program: Each state runs its own Medicaid program, with its own collection of regulations and regulations pertaining to covered advantages.
Medical Necessity: Medicaid may call for documents from a doctor to develop the clinical requirement of adult baby diapers. This usually entails a medical diagnosis of a problem that requires their usage, such as urinary incontinence or flexibility limitations.
Revenue Eligibility: Medicaid eligibility is based upon earnings and other qualification standards. Individuals need to meet these demands to get approved for insurance coverage.
Medicaid Managed Care Plans: If you are registered in a Medicaid managed care plan, the particular benefits covered might differ from those provided by the state Medicaid program.
Actions to Establish Coverage.

Get In Touch With Your State Medicaid Firm: The most trustworthy method to figure out whether Medicaid covers grown-up baby diapers in your state is to call your state's Medicaid firm directly. They can give particular info concerning coverage requirements and eligibility standards.
Seek advice from Your Doctor: Your doctor can aid you gather the needed paperwork to sustain your ask for adult baby diaper coverage. They may also be able to give guidance on the Medicaid application process.
